CONWAY, Ark. - The Hendrix College women's basketball team lost their Southern Athletic Association opener to #20 Rhodes College 72-34 at Grove Gymnasium on Wednesday night.
The visiting Lynx (5-0, 1-0) led 32-20, then scored the first 23 points of the second half to control the game.
The Warriors (2-5, 0-1) shot just 24 percent (12-of-51) from the field for the game, and was 2-of-16 from outside and 8-of-12 at the free throw line. Rhodes shot 40 percent (29-of-72) from the field, 8-of-26 from three-point range and 6-of-7 from the line. The Lynx held a 53-32 rebound advantage, and scored 27 second chance points, compared to just three for the Warriors.
Sophomore guard
Caitlin Kriesel-Bigler led the Orange & Black with seven points to go with four rebounds. Senior forward
Katie Coughran came off the bench to score six points and sophomore guard
Estrella Flores had five. Freshman guard
Melanie Martin had three assists and two steals.
All-American Lauren Avant led Rhodes with 26 points and 14 rebounds to go with four assists, two steals and two blocks. Dy'Nelle Todman scored 12 points and guard Sarah Johnson had 10 points, eight assists and six boards.
Hendrix will host Rust College on Monday in non-conference action.
